MacTeX 问题:TexShop 无法在 macOS Monterey 中找到 pdflatex

MacTeX 问题:TexShop 无法在 macOS Monterey 中找到 pdflatex

我是 MacTeX 的新用户。我在运行 macOS Monterey 12.5 的 Mac 上。安装 MacTeX(并使用 MD5 和检查包)后,我尝试在 TeXShop 中排版 LatexTemplate,但出现以下错误:

/Library/TeX/texbin/pdflatex does not exist. TeXShop is a front end for TeX, but you also need a TeX distribution. Perhaps such a distribution was not installed or was removed during a system upgrade. If so, go to http://tug.org/mactex and follow the instructions to install MacTeX or BasicTeX.

在 Finder 中,如果我转到 /Library/TeX,我可以找到 texbin 别名。但是,在终端中,如果我运行which pdflatex它,它会返回pdflatex not found。运行sudo which pdflatex并输入我的管理员密码,结果/Library/TeX/texbin/pdflatex如预期一样。

在 TeXShop 偏好设置中,我的“引擎”选项卡下的“路径设置”已设置为/Library/TeX/texbin,并/usr/local/bin按照 tex.stackexchange 其他地方的建议进行设置。

macOS Monterey 中的库权限是否存在问题?我在系统偏好设置中启用了 TeXShop 和 TeX Live Utility 的完全磁盘访问权限,但这并没有帮助。我还删除了所有旧版本的 TeX、GUI 应用程序和 TeX 分发数据结构,并完全重新安装了 MacTeX,但这也没有帮助。

答案1

更新:看起来位于的别名/Library/TeX/由于某种原因被破坏了,或者由于权限问题无法被 TeXShop 访问。当我将 TeXShop 中的 (pdf)TeX Path 设置设置为时,/usr/local/texlive/2022/bin/universal-darwin/它能够编译。

相关内容